No, the Moto 4 isn't the warrior. I was able to figure out how the swing arms were held in. One side bearing was gone, the other side looks ok, but since I went thru all the trouble to get it apart, I might as well change it to. I am going to a bearing shop today. Should be alot cheaper than thru a Yamaha dealer. The bearing is pretty standard in ATV's & motorcycles. It is a Koyo bearing #30203J.

I have owned 2 Clymer manuals in the past. Both would leave out some small things necessary to do the job right. Just take a look at the Clymer manual.....no-where near as thick as the factory manual.....and thats for a reason.....lack of information. Best way to go, if you cannot find a free downloadable factory service manual, is to stop in at your local dealership and obtain a PROPER maintenance manual for the atv. It will be more expersive that the Clymer manual, but well worth the extra cash outlay. Expect to pay around $50 if your dealer can't get you a deal on one.
